Mejoras en RPC
- Incluir blockHash, epochHash, epochNumber, transactionHash y transactionPosition para los RPCs de rastreo.
Tenga en cuenta que el formato de los datos devueltos por trace_block es incompatible con las versiones antiguas. - Añade un nuevo campo offset en los filtros de registro utilizados en cfx_getLogs.
Si se especifica, la respuesta omitirá los últimos registros compensados.
Por ejemplo, con 10 registros coincidentes (0…9) y offset=0x1, limit=0x5, la respuesta contendrá los registros 4…8.
Nota: Aunque especifique el desplazamiento, los registros correspondientes deben ser procesados por el nodo, por lo que un filtro con desplazamiento=10000, límite=10 tiene aproximadamente el mismo rendimiento que un filtro con desplazamiento=0, límite=100010. - Añade un nuevo parámetro subscription_epoch al pubsub epochs.
Los valores soportados son “latest_mined” (por defecto) y “latest_state”. - Añade cfx_getAccountPendingInfo para obtener información de transacciones pendientes de alguna cuenta para investigar mejor los problemas de tx pendientes.
Mejoras en la configuración
- Permitir empaquetar inmediatamente las transacciones enviadas en el modo dev manteniendo dev_block_interval_ms sin configurar.
Tenga en cuenta que al establecer dev_block_interval_ms se deshabilitará este empaquetamiento inmediato y se generarán bloques sólo periódicamente.
Mejoras en el rendimiento
- Optimización de la implementación del estado para mejorar el rendimiento de la caché.
Corrección de errores
- Se ha corregido un error que hace que los nodos en modo dev no generen bloques automáticamente.
Descargar
La nueva versión del programa de nodos se puede descargar en [http://github.com/Conflux-Chain/conflux-rust/releases]
Soy un operador/minero de nodo, ¿qué tengo que hacer?
Si ha iniciado el nodo, necesita suspender el funcionamiento del nodo primero, y luego reemplazar el archivo ejecutable llamado “conflux” en el directorio de ejecución del programa de nodo original con el archivo ejecutable Conflux del programa de nodo Conflux v1.1.3. Se puede reiniciar más tarde.
Si inicia un nuevo nodo, puede descargar la última versión de Conflux v1.1.3 y ejecutarla.
¿Qué ocurrirá si no actualizo los nodos o me niego a hacerlo?
En circunstancias normales, no habrá problemas. Esta actualización no afecta al contenido de la capa de consenso, por lo que es tu decisión actualizar o no.
¿Qué impacto tendrá en los usuarios normales?
Durante el proceso de actualización de los nodos que funcionan en la cadena, algunos servicios pueden verse afectados y retrasados. Una vez finalizada la actualización de los nodos, todo volverá a la normalidad.
Gracias a nuestra comunidad por su apoyo!
Un sincero agradecimiento a la comunidad Conflux y a todos los desarrolladores del ecosistema Conflux. Gracias por vuestro duro trabajo, vuestras ideas y vuestras contribuciones. ¡Por un futuro mejor!